INSTANT-OFF®  Linking to Water Conservation Efforts: Water Use it Wisely Water Sense Water Conserve Water Conservation USA  UNESCO WWAP Why INSTANT-OFF® Takes Water Conservation So Seriously Preservation and protection of our water resources and the wise use of them is one of the greatest environmental concerns facing the global population.  While 71% of the planet’s surface is covered by water, less than 3% is considered “potable” or fit for human consumption.  Growing populations, particularly in major urban areas, is rapidly depleting reservoirs and aquifers.  This issue has become more compelling with recent events, such as the city of Atlanta nearly running out of water and reservoirs actually running dry in other major metropolitan centers.   With many major population centers around the world facing unprecedented droughts, the issue of water conservation has quickly been pushed to the forefront.  The average American household uses over 125,000 gallons of water annually.  Twice the average consumption of the rest of the world.  We use more than our fair share, which is resulting in the depletion of aquifers across the country faster than nature can replenish them.
